You set prices months before doors open and find out if you were right when the house lights go down.

Live events are perishable inventory. Every unsold seat at showtime is revenue that is gone forever. But the decisions that determine whether a show sells out or loses money happen weeks or months before the event, often based on gut instinct, last year's comps, and a spreadsheet that stops getting updated after week two.

Static pricing in a dynamic market

You set ticket prices at on-sale and rarely adjust, even as demand signals shift and comparable events in your market sell out or struggle

Demand is invisible until it is too late

You see ticket velocity but not the signals that predict it: social mentions, presale engagement, comparable event performance, and local market conditions

Ancillary revenue is an afterthought

F&B, parking, VIP upgrades, and merchandise are priced once and forgotten. The difference between a $48 and a $72 per-head night lives in the details nobody tracks

Post-event learning is manual

Show recaps take days to compile. By the time the data is ready, the next three events have already gone on sale with the same assumptions
